Design Of Heart Rate Equipment Base On Bluetooth Communication On Bike Speedometers
A person heartbeat in a minute or so known as a Beat Per Minute (BPM), is one of the indicators of one’s health. Many tools that can help sports activities in cycling, one of the pulse sensors used to be able to detect heart rate. Arduino acts as the brain in this tool. Arduino is powered trough a voltage source of a 9V DC battery. From the voltage source, Arduino will supply the voltage for the pulse sensor and Bluetooth HC05. Pulse sensor will be given voltage by Arduino of 5V and Bluetooth get voltage equal to 3,3 V. When all component have active which will be shown on LCD which applied to handlebar bike.
